SILBERMAN, Judge.

We affirm Frank W. Roberto, Jr.'s, convictions and sentences for fleeing or eluding a law enforcement officer and vehicular homicide without prejudice to any right he may have to file a motion pursuant to Florida Rule of Criminal Procedure 3.800(a) with respect to prison credit. See McCall v. State, 88 So. 3d 1015, 1016 (Fla. 2d DCA 2012).

KELLY and VILLANTI, JJ., Concur.
